At approximately the same latitude as some of the famous French wine regions, the Puget Sound Region's vineyards in Washington State take advantage of averaging two additional hours of sun per Summer day than their California counterparts. These extra two hours help the grapes ripen earlier, making this Appellation’s specialties the Pinot Noir, Chardonnay, Madeline Angevine, Muller Thurgau, and Siegerebbe.
The Puget Sound Wine Country, centered near Seattle, Washington hosts events all year, ranging from barrel tastings, picnics, and many other events combining good food and local wines.
Visitors will find the wineries wrapped in and around the waters and islands that make up the Northwest’s Puget Sound. More than a half dozen wineries can be seen by driving a loop around the Puget Sound, some ferry rides are necessary to see all the wineries and complete the loop. For those new to the area, the Puget Sound also offers numerous fresh seafood restaurants, shopping, ferry rides, and natural observation points.
